The Role of Experiential Learning
Experiential learning provides an effective way to bridge the theory-practice gap by offering hands-on experiences that complement theoretical knowledge. Through practical exercises, projects, and simulations, individuals can apply theoretical concepts in real-world contexts, fostering deeper understanding and retention. This approach not only enhances learning outcomes but also develops essential skills such as critical thinking, creativity, and problem-solving.
Case Study: Implementing Experiential Learning
In the field of STEM education, experiential learning has been shown to be highly effective in promoting student engagement and academic achievement. A study conducted by a research team found that students who participated in hands-on science experiments demonstrated significant improvements in their understanding of complex scientific concepts compared to those who relied solely on theoretical instruction.
